Day 2 : Padar Island - Pink Beach - Komodo Island
Day 3 : Whale Shark - Mata Jitu Waterfall - Kenawa Island
Your day begins with a 5:00 AM wake-up call, getting you ready for a special experience. By 6:00 AM, you’ll arrive at Teluk Saleh for a chance to encounter whale sharks up close. After this unforgettable moment, the journey continues to Moyo Island, where you’ll explore the beautiful Mata Jitu Waterfall, known for its crystal-clear cascades and lush surroundings. From Moyo, the boat sets sail toward Kenawa Island, where it will anchor for the night, allowing you to relax and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ere.
Your day starts early with a 5:00 AM wake-up call, followed by a sunrise trek to the top of Padar Island for breathtaking panoramic views. Afterward, continue the journey with a visit to the iconic Pink Beach, perfect for relaxing or snorkeling in crystal-clear waters. Next, explore Komodo Island to see the legendary Komodo dragons in their natural habitat. Later in the day, the boat begins its journey from Komodo National Park to Sumbawa, with an overnight sail under the stars.


Day 1 : Labuan Bajo - Sieba - Manta Point - Taka Makassar
Your journey begins with a pick-up from your hotel or the airport in Labuan Bajo. From there, you'll head to the harbor, where the boat sets sail and the adventure officially begins. The first destination is Siaba Island, followed by an exciting visit to Manta Point and the beautiful sandbank of Taka Makassar. As the day comes to a close, enjoy a stunning sunset at Taka Makassar before the boat anchors for the night near Padar Island.






Day 4 : Kenawa Island - Nemu Beach - Lombok
Your day starts with a 5:00 AM wake-up call to enjoy the early morning serenity. The first stop is Kenawa Island, where you can take in the scenic views or go for a short trek. Afterward, continue to the peaceful shores of Nemu Beach for some final moments of relaxation. Following the beach visit, the boat begins its return journey to Kayangan Harbor. By 12:30 PM, you’ll check out from the boat upon arrival at the harbor, marking the end of your memorable sailing adventure.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is transportation from the Gili Islands to Bangsal port in Lombok included in the package?
No, transportation from the Gilis to Bangsal port is not included in the package. But don’t worry—it’s very easy to find a speedboat or public ferry, with a travel time of around 30 minutes. We’ll be happy to guide you on the best options.
What time should I book my flight from Labuan Bajo after the tour ends?
The tour typically ends around 13:00 PM in Labuan Bajo. We recommend booking a flight no earlier than 5:00 PM (17:00) to allow time for docking, disembarkation, and transfer to the airport. However, to avoid stress, some travelers choose to stay one night in Labuan Bajo and fly out the next day.
Is it safe for beginners or people who can’t swim?
Yes, it’s generally safe even for beginners or non-swimmers. Life jackets are provided, and the crew is trained for safety. However, we recommend informing the team in advance so they can give extra attention during water activities.
What kind of boat will we be sailing on?
You’ll be on a traditional wooden boat equipped with shared or private cabins (depending on the package), dining area, sun deck, and clean bathroom facilities. Safety equipment and a trained crew are also on board to ensure a smooth and comfortable journey.
